ADULT DAY SERVICES

Facility Based

  • Work training through sub-contracting with industry

  • Includes assembly work, mass mailing, and shrink-wrapping

Community Based

  • Provides access to and inclusion in community life that is desired by the general population

  • Inclusion will result in a better qualify of life and more dignity for people with disabilities

Supportive Employment

Provides job training and placement for the most severely disabled individuals who have been determined as job ready due to their skills as well as their ability to adjust socially into the competitive work environment.

Work Adjustment

  • This service is for individuals who are sixteen years of age or older and qualify under guidelines established by the Division of Rehabilitation Services and for those individuals who have developed a disability or illness and are attempting to re-enter the work force. 

  • Prospect provides intense work training before entering the work force.

These services are offered in Wilson, Smith and Dekalb counties.
